The owner of the premises licensed or to be licensed would not qualify for a <br /> license under the terms of this Section. <br /> <br />7.94.17 Off-site storage. Upon written request, the police chief may approve an off-site <br />locked and secured storage facility. The dealer shall permit inspection of the facility in <br />accordance with section 7.94.06. All provisions of this Section regarding record keeping and <br />reporting apply to the facility and its contents. Property shall be stored in compliance with all <br />provisions of the city code. The dealer must either own the building in which the business is <br />conducted, and any approved off-site storage facility, or have a lease on the business premises. <br /> <br />7.94.18 Separability. Should any Section, section, subsection, clause or other provision of <br />this ordinance be declared by a court of competent jurisdiction to be invalid, such decision shall <br />not effect the validity of the ordinance as a whole or any part other than the part so declared <br />invalid. <br /> <br />SECTION 2. SUMMARY <br /> <br />The following is an official summary of Ordinance #03-49 adding a section to Chapter 7 of the <br />Ramsey City Code entitled "Licensing and Permits". The adoption of this ordinance adds <br />Section 7.94 entitled "Secondhand Goods Dealers". The purpose of the language is to prevent <br />secondhand goods dealer shops from being used as facilities for commission of crimes and to <br />assure that such businesses comply with basic consumer protection standards. A complete copy <br />of the ordinance is available for review at Ramsey City Hall. <br /> <br />SECTION 3. EFFECTIVE DATE <br /> <br />This Ordinance becomes effective upon its passage and thirty (30) days after its publication <br />according to law, subject to City Charter Provision, Section 5.04. <br /> <br /> PASSED by the City Council of the City of Ramsey, Minnesota, the 25th day of <br />November, 2003. <br /> <br /> TTEST'.-., Mayor <br /> <br />Posting dates: November 11 - November 26, 2003 <br />Adoption date: November 25, 2003 <br />Publication date: December 5, 2003 <br />Effective date: January 5, 2004 <br /> <br /> <br />
